North America Wind Power Doubly-fed Converter Market Driver and Trends
The North American wind power industry is experiencing significant growth, driven by increasing investments in renewable energy projects and a strong push towards achieving carbon neutrality. The demand for efficient power conversion systems, such as doubly-fed converters (DFCs), is rising as they improve grid stability and enhance the performance of wind turbines. The adoption of DFCs enables the integration of variable wind energy into the grid, making them crucial for wind farms across the region. With favorable government incentives and an emphasis on sustainable power generation, the market for DFCs is expected to expand rapidly in the coming years.
Additionally, advancements in technology are fostering the growth of the doubly-fed converter market in North America. Manufacturers are focusing on enhancing the efficiency, reliability, and cost-effectiveness of these systems, which has led to the adoption of more sophisticated DFCs for large-scale wind energy projects. As the region continues to invest in renewable energy infrastructure, there is an increasing trend toward offshore wind farms, which also require DFCs for optimal performance. Moreover, the growing need for energy storage solutions is further boosting the demand for wind power systems integrated with advanced DFC technologies.

1. What is a doubly-fed converter in the context of wind power?
A doubly-fed converter is a type of power converter used in the generation of wind energy.
2. How does a doubly-fed converter work in a wind turbine?
A doubly-fed converter allows for variable speed operation of the wind turbine, improving its efficiency and power output.

13. What are the main advantages of using doubly-fed converters in wind power generation?
Advantages include improved grid stability, better control of power output, and reduced mechanical stress on the turbine.
14. What are the main disadvantages of using doubly-fed converters in wind power generation?
Disadvantages include higher maintenance requirements and potential for electrical losses.
